ANI OHEV OTACH


Explanation:
man to a woman: ANI OHEV OTACH
woman to a man: ANI OHEVET OT-CHA
man to a man: ANI OHEV OT-CHA
woman to woman: ANI OHEVET OTACH

ani ohev(et) etkhem/etkhen


Explanation:
In addition to the singular series
M sg.>M sg. ani ohev otkha (אני אוהב אותך)
M sg.>F sg. ani ohev otakh (id.)
F sg.>M sg. ani ohevet otkha (אני אוהבת אותך)
F sg.>F sg. ani ohevet otakh (id.),
we must consider the plural ones:
M sg.>M pl. ani ohev etkhem (אני אוהב אתכם)
M sg.>F pl. ani ohev etkhen (אני אוהב אתכן)
F sg.>M pl. ani ohevet etkhem (אני אוהבת אתכם)
F sg.>F pl. ani ohevet etkhen (אני אוהבת אתכן).
